Location:-

CIAT-3 CRPF Kalikiri is located at Kalikiri,Annamayya District in Andhra Pradesh. Traditionally local folklore dictates the name "Kalikiri" originates from two dancing sisters, Kalki and Kulki, who were given the land by the local ruler. Kalikiri is a town with a population of around 25,000 inAnnamayya district of Andhra Pradesh. The culture of Kalikiri is a mixture of Rayalaseema and Dravidian cultures. The town is famous for its Tomato market, which supplies Tomatoes to other districts in Andhra Pradesh and other nearby states.


About Camp:-


CIAT – 3 CRPF Kalikiri is spread over in 175 acres of land. A Common Firing Range in 169.24 Acres of land is adjacent to this Institution and is also looked after by this Institute. The terrain of the School is hilly/ Rocky with thorny bushes. Camp is about a distance of 5 km away from Kalikiri town. Presently the Institution is functioning in 70 Nos PF Huts and the infrastructure is developing very fast. The campus of 53 Bn ITBP and Rear Hqr of 65 Bn BSF are also located adjacent to this campus. MHA land for the construction of Hospital and Kendriya Vidyalaya is also adjacent to this Institute.

How to reach:-


1. By Road:-

                       Kalikiri is well connected by road with regular bus service from Tirupati (75 Kms), Chittoor(70 Kms) and Renigunta (90Kms). It is also having good road transport connectivity between Kalikiri - Bengaluru (Approx.180 Kms) and Kalikiri – Chennai (Approx.210 Kms).


2. Nearest Railway Station:-


            1.Kalikiri – (05 Kms from the Camp) with very limited Trains and having stoppage of short duration only.

            2. Tirupati and Renigunta - (75 Kms and 90 Kms respectively from the Camp) are the Main Railway Stations for the trainees coming from North India

            3. Chittoor- (70 Kms from the Camp) is the Main Railway Station for trainees coming from South India.


3.Nearest Airport :-         Tirupati Airport at Renigunta, Tirupati District (AP) (102 Kms from the Camp).


Climate:-

                   Kalikiri is having a pleasant weather throughout the year. Moderately warm with average temperatures between 20 to 40 degrees Celsius during Summer. Summer lasts from March to June and the Rainy Season starts in July, followed by Winter Season, which starts in the month of November and lasts till the end of February. Winter is also moderate with average temperatures between 15 to 25 Degree Celsius.
